聊天机器人API如何支持图片与文件交互?

随着互联网技术的飞速发展,人工智能逐渐渗透到我们的日常生活中。聊天机器人作为人工智能的一个重要分支,已经广泛应用于客服、教育、娱乐等领域。而随着用户需求的不断升级,聊天机器人API也逐渐具备了支持图片与文件交互的功能。本文将讲述一位聊天机器人的故事,带您了解它是如何实现这一功能的。

故事的主人公名叫小智,是一款基于某知名聊天机器人平台的智能客服。小智自诞生以来,一直致力于为用户提供便捷、高效的服务。然而,在早期的发展过程中,小智的交互能力相对有限,只能通过文字与用户进行沟通。这使得小智在处理一些复杂问题时显得力不从心。

有一天,一位名叫小王的用户通过小智的客服平台咨询一款新产品的使用方法。在沟通过程中,小王遇到了一些难题,他希望通过发送图片或文件来展示具体问题。然而,小智却无法识别这些非文字信息,导致沟通陷入僵局。小王无奈之下,只能通过其他渠道寻求帮助。

这件事让小智的开发团队意识到了自身在功能上的不足。为了提升用户体验,团队决定对小智进行升级,使其具备图片与文件交互的能力。经过一番努力,小智终于实现了这一功能。

以下是小智实现图片与文件交互的步骤:

  1. 数据传输:当用户发送图片或文件时,聊天机器人API会将这些信息转换为可识别的数据格式,如Base64编码。

  2. 服务器处理:聊天机器人服务器接收到数据后,会对其进行解析,提取图片或文件中的关键信息。

  3. 识别与分类:根据提取出的信息,聊天机器人API会对图片或文件进行识别与分类,如识别图片中的物体、文字等。

  4. 功能调用:根据识别结果,聊天机器人API会调用相应的功能模块,如图片识别、文件解析等,对图片或文件进行处理。

  5. 结果展示:处理完成后,聊天机器人API会将结果以文字、图片或文件的形式展示给用户。

以小王咨询产品使用方法为例,以下是小智实现图片与文件交互的过程:

  1. 小王通过聊天界面发送了一张产品说明书图片。

  2. 小智的聊天机器人API将图片转换为Base64编码的数据格式。

  3. 服务器接收到数据后,对图片进行解析,提取出产品名称、型号、使用方法等信息。

  4. 根据提取出的信息,聊天机器人API调用图片识别功能,识别出产品名称和型号。

  5. 小智向小王展示识别结果:“您咨询的是XX型号的产品,以下是该产品的使用方法……”

通过以上步骤,小智成功实现了图片与文件交互的功能。这一功能不仅提升了用户体验,还让小智在处理复杂问题时更加得心应手。

在实际应用中,小智的图片与文件交互功能得到了广泛的应用。以下是一些典型案例:

  1. 客服领域:当用户在购物过程中遇到问题时,可以通过发送产品图片或说明书,让客服快速了解问题,并提供相应的解决方案。

  2. 教育领域:教师可以通过发送教学课件或图片,与学生进行互动,提高课堂效果。

  3. 医疗领域:医生可以通过发送病例图片或检查报告,与其他医生进行远程会诊。

  4. 娱乐领域:用户可以通过发送图片或文件,与聊天机器人进行趣味互动,如猜谜语、玩小游戏等。

总之,聊天机器人API支持图片与文件交互的功能,为用户带来了更加丰富、便捷的体验。在未来,随着人工智能技术的不断发展,相信聊天机器人将在更多领域发挥重要作用,为我们的生活带来更多便利。而小智的故事,也只是一个开始。

猜你喜欢:智能客服机器人